免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发员配置

App开发是指利用各种技术手段开发移动应用程序的过程。在进行App开发之前,开发者需要进行一系列的配置工作,以确保能够顺利进行开发和测试工作。本文将详细介绍App开发员在配置过程中需要了解和掌握的知识。

首先,开发者需要了解和熟悉开发环境。开发环境是指开发者用来进行App开发的软件和硬件设备。常见的开发环境包括操作系统、开发工具和开发语言等。对于移动应用开发,常见的操作系统有iOS和Android,开发工具有Xcode和Android Studio,开发语言有Objective-C/Swift和Java/Kotlin。开发者需要根据自己的需求选择合适的开发环境,并进行相应的安装和配置。

接下来,开发者需要了解和熟悉应用程序接口(API)。API是指应用程序提供给开发者使用的一组函数和方法,用于实现特定功能或访问特定服务。在App开发中,常见的API包括网络API、地图API和社交媒体API等。开发者需要学习如何使用这些API,并在开发过程中进行相应的配置和调用。

此外,开发者还需要了解和熟悉数据库管理系统。数据库管理系统是用于存储和管理应用程序数据的软件。在App开发中,常见的数据库管理系统有SQLite和Core Data(iOS)以及SQLite和Room(Android)。开发者需要学习如何使用这些数据库管理系统,并进行相应的配置和操作。

除了以上内容,开发者还需要了解和熟悉版本控制系统。版本控制系统是用于记录和管理代码变更的工具。常见的版本控制系统有Git和SVN。开发者需要学习如何使用版本控制系统,并进行相应的配置和操作,以便能够方便地进行代码管理和团队协作。

最后,开发者还需要了解和熟悉移动应用发布和分发的流程。移动应用的发布和分发是指将开发完成的应用程序提交到应用商店或其他分发渠道,并进行审核和上线的过程。开发者需要了解不同应用商店的规则和要求,并进行相应的配置和调整,以确保应用程序能够顺利通过审核并上线。

综上所述,App开发员在进行开发工作之前需要进行一系列的配置工作。这些配置工作包括了解和熟悉开发环境、应用程序接口、数据库管理系统、版本控制系统以及应用发布和分发流程等。只有掌握了这些知识和技能,开发者才能够顺利地进行App开发工作,并开发出高质量的移动应用程序。


相关知识:
秦皇岛建材app开发费用情况
秦皇岛建材是一家以建材销售为主的企业,为了更好地服务客户,提升销售额,开发一款建材app是非常必要的。那么,秦皇岛建材app开发费用是多少呢?这个问题需要从以下几个方面来考虑。1. 功能需求首先需要确定秦皇岛建材app的功能需求,这将直接影响到开发费用。一
2024-01-10
flutter开发第一个app
Flutter是一个由Google开发的开源UI工具包,可用于构建跨平台的移动应用程序。它提供了丰富的组件和功能,使得开发者可以快速地构建出美观、高性能的应用。在开始开发第一个Flutter应用程序之前,你需要安装Flutter SDK并配置好开发环境。具
2023-07-14
e4a只能开发app吗
e4a(易语言开发环境)是一款集成开发环境,主要用于开发Windows平台下的软件应用。它由中国程序员魏志强开发,并于2001年首次发布。e4a以其简单易用、学习曲线低等特点受到很多初学者的喜爱。e4a并非只能用于开发手机应用,它可以用于开发多种类型的软件
2023-07-14
app开发企业有哪些
在当今数字化时代,移动应用程序(App)已经成为人们日常生活中必不可少的工具之一。为了满足人们对移动应用的需求,越来越多的企业开始涉足App开发领域。下面将介绍一些知名的App开发企业,包括其原理和详细介绍。1. Google: Google是全球知名
2023-06-29
app开发工具获取对方信息
在开发一个app时,很有可能需要获取到用户的信息。这些信息可能包括用户的个人信息、设备信息、位置信息等等。在这篇文章中,我将向你详细介绍如何获取对方信息以及其原理。首先,我们需要了解一些基本概念。在app中,最常用的两个组件是Activity和Servic
2023-06-29
app开发nfc功能
## NFC功能在App开发中的应用及原理详解近年来,移动支付、无钥匙门禁、票务等领域的日益普及,让NFC(Near Field Communication)技术变得越来越热门。本文将详细介绍NFC技术的原理、应用场景,以及如何在App开发中实现NFC功能
2023-06-29